Article 3
Supreme Court (9 justices)
·
They rule on any
cases arising from the constitution
·
***Judicial
Review*** Supreme Court’s ability to judge constitutionality of a law,
treaty, lower court decision, etc.
·
Federal courts –
lower courts in major cities
·
Qualifications –
none
·
Term – life time
term
·
Section 3: treason – giving aid/comfort to an enemy
Article 4
Relationships
between states:
Section
2:
·
Citizen of one
state, you’re one of all
·
Criminals that
flee from one state to another, must be returned
Section
3:
·
No state can be
split up into two, or no two states can
form into one without Congress vote
Section
4:
·
Each new state
must be a republic (representative democracy)
